As a leader, Caesar made very few reforms that benefited the Roman people. O True O False​

Respuesta :

wbfeddyr07
wbfeddyr07 wbfeddyr07
  • 11-02-2021

Answer:

False.

Explanation:

He was a dictator and he did little to help the people but he used his power to carry out much-needed reform, relieving debt, enlarging the senate, building the Forum Iulium and revising the calendar.
